O2 Academy Birmingham
∙
Birmingham
Tuesday, April 29
Tuesday, April 29 at 7 pm
Thursday, May 1
Thursday, May 1 at 7 pm
Friday, May 2
Friday, May 2 at 7 pm
Saturday, May 3
Saturday, May 3 at 7 pm
Friday, May 9
Friday, May 9 at 7 pm
Saturday, May 10
Saturday, May 10 at 7 pm
Wednesday, May 14
Wednesday, May 14 at 7 pm
Saturday, May 17
Saturday, May 17 at 7 pm
Tuesday, May 20
Tuesday, May 20 at 7 pm
Wednesday, May 21
Wednesday, May 21 at 7 pm
16-18 Horse Fair